Do you want to change the FM band on your Artemis?

To my surprise, it is indeed possible! … :) … An xda-developers forum contributor with the nick name Adenin came with a nice tweak that can change the FM band range in HTC Artemis. The registry modifications are the following:

HKLM\SOFTWARE\HTC\FMRadio\FMPlayer\Band
0 = 87.5 – 108.0 MHz
1 = 76.0 – 108.0 MHz
2 = 76.0 – 91.0 MHz

You can also set frequency direct in HKLM\SOFTWARE\HTC\FMRadio\FMPlayer\ChannelValue = MHz * 10 (=> 1100 = 110.0 MHz )

Two GPS utilities …

Recentely I tested two GPS utilities for WindowsMobile PDA‘s. The first of them is called VisualGPSce and works very well on HTC Artemis. VisualGPSce is GPS software that displays GPS data in both text and graphical form. Moreover, the data can be exported into a file. You can find more information here.


The second utility I was testing on HTC Artemis is called GPSAuto. Installation runs OK but while trying to access the GPS, the utility freezes and PDA has to be restarted. It is a pity as I would welcome some advanced speed-watching software. Anyway, the product pages are here.

My TomTom menu

After a few weeks of using TomTom Navigator 6, I was able to rearrange the application and settings menu. I believe that handling of the application is now much more comfortable than it was with the default settings. For customizing the TomTom menu, I used a program called TomTom Menu Designer. If you are interested you can download my TomTom.mnu file here; TomTom Menu Designer is available here. When you finish your own TomTom.mnu, you have to copy the file into the root directory of your PDA into the TomTom/SdkRegistry folder. If you want to get back the default TomTom menu, you just delete the TomTom.mnu file or the folders.

Do you know TeleAtlas?

One of the companies that TomTom uses for their navigation maps is TeleAtlas. Recently I have been searching the TeleAtlas website and found some interesting information there. What hit my eyes at the very beginning was a product datasheet with detailed European maps descriptions. Here are some of the details for CZE maps (i.e. Czech Republic, Product Release MultiNet 2007.01):

Fully Attributed population: 52,8%
Municipality: 199
Inhabitants: 5.399.271

Basic Attributed population: 47,2%
Municipality: 6.049
Inhabitants: 4.829.932

InterConnecting Network (ICNW) population: 100%
Municipality: 6.248
Inhabitants: 10.232.907

Major Road Network (MRNW) population: 100%
Municipality: 6.248
Inhabitants: 10.232.907

Road total: 141.568 km
House number ranges: 25,99%
Points of Interest: 54.748
• Petrol Station: 2.098
• Restaurant: 6.802
• Parking Garage: 68
• Tourist Information Office: 400
• Hotel: 2.802
• Airport: 5
• Rest Area: 88
• Open Parking Area: 1.386

DUN missing …

In this list of bluetooth profiles that are supported by HTC Artemis, I did not mention probably one of the most „famous“ profiles called DUN (the abbreviation stands for Dial-Up Networking). The reason was that it is missing in the Artemis‘ bluetooth stack. A very good explanation of how DUN was substituted by PAN can be found here. The change is present in all AKU3 ROM’s that are installed in WindowsMobile 2005 devices. As mentioned in the text, the problem is that not all other bluetooth devices can handle PAN. Artemis inside: GPS

According to this press release that was published recentely, the HTC Artemis uses a GPS chip GSC3 produced by the SiRF company. A datasheet and other technical information can be found here. Key parameters (as declared by the manufacturer) are the following:

  • 140-ball grid array (BGA) with a pitch of 0.65 mm
  • Pb free
  • 7 mm x 10 mm x 1.4 mm
  • SiRFstarIII™ GSP CoreDigital and RF in a single package
  • 50-MHz ARM7TDMI processor plus 1 Mb SRAM
  • SiRFLoc Client A-GPS multi-standard support
  • 4 Mbit flash memory
  • Low Power
